In September 2021, the university announced UTokyo Compass, a set of principles, goals, and specific actions that will guide the university in the coming decades, centered on the theme “Into a Sea of Diversity: Creating the Future through Dialogue.” In accordance with UTokyo Compass, the D&I Statement was created based on an awareness of how extremely important it is for the university to promote diversity and inclusion in order to achieve academic excellence, create knowledge innovation, and cultivate human resources who can act globally. In recent years, the very concept of diversity has expanded to include gender and sexual diversity (including sexual orientation and gender identity) and lifestyle diversity, reflecting a broadening of values. In recognition of these changes, the statement is intended to make clear that the university provides opportunities to participate in its activities equally and fairly.
